



3M
477
Transparent Vinyl Tape
3M477 is a 7.2 mil. conformable transparent vinyl backing with a rubber adhesive ideal for many heavy duty protection applications, as well as masking and splicing. Best results are attained when applied to a clean, dry surface at temperatures between 60°F to 80°F. Conformability and dead stretch properties make 477 tape ideal for taping or sealing many curved and irregular surfaces. The thick backing is ideal for application which require abrasion protection. While 477 tape resists most common solvents, care should be taken to avoid ketones, chlorinated hydrocarbons and esters that are found in lacquer thinners, degreasers, paint strippers, etc. which may cause the backing to swell or curl. Avoid using on highly plastized materials which may result in adhesive softening and potential adhesion failure. To obtain best tape performance, use within 12 months from date of manufacture and store under normal conditions of 60°F to 80°F and 40% to 60% relative humidity in the original carton.

Backing/Carrier | PVC - Polyvinylchloride |
---|---|
Adhesive | Rubber |
Thickness | 7.2 Mils |
Tensile | 24.00 lbs/in |
---|---|
Elongation | 230.00% |
Adhesive Activation | Pressure |
Adhesion (unwind) | 24 oz/in |
Min. Application Temp | 60° F |
---|---|
Min. Service Temp | 0° F |

Adhesive Tape Applications
- Protection of parts from abrasion
- Masking for electroplating and anodizing
- Splicing of wrestling mats and similar type products
